PB 電子会議室
発言No. | 更新日 | 題名(クリックすると発言内容と関連するコメントが表示されます) |
---|---|---|
15714 | 01/07/09 12:27:24 | RE(3):PB6.5: DWCtrl:LoseFocusでthis.SetFocus()をするとカーソルが消える? By こてちゅ |
15713 | 01/07/09 11:51:49 | RE(2):PB6.5: DWCtrl:LoseFocusでthis.SetFocus()をするとカーソルが消える? By wata-m |
15712 | 01/07/09 11:43:15 | RE(1):PB6.5: DWCtrl:LoseFocusでthis.SetFocus()をするとカーソルが消える? By こてちゅ |
15711 | 01/07/09 10:47:08 | PB6.5: DWCtrl:LoseFocusでthis.SetFocus()をするとカーソルが消える? By wata-m |
カテゴリ:スクリプトの記述
日付:2001年07月09日 12:27 発信者:こてちゅ
題名:RE(3):PB6.5: DWCtrl:LoseFocusでthis.SetFocus()をするとカーソルが消える?
wata-mさん、こんにちは。
本来、LoseFocusでAcceptTextやSetFocusするのはよくない(ヘルプを参照)ので、
Windowに貼り付けているコントロール数が多くないのであれば、
フォーカスが移った先のコントロールでAcceptTextするのがいいんですけど・・・
全く関係のないカラムにSetColumnして元に戻すようなことを
ItemChangedイベントに書いておくとかするとどうなりますかね?
(このとき、SelectTextとかしておくと、見た目でわかりやすくなるんですが・・・)
あと、今の状況でFocusがDWに戻っている時に、矢印キーなどでカーソルを
移動したりするとそのカラム上でカーソルは現れるのでしょうか?
付加情報:
PowerBuilder Version (記載なし)
Client SoftWare
OS Windows NT 4.0
DBMS Sybase Open Client/C 11
Browser (記載なし)
Server SoftWare
OS (記載なし)
DBMS (記載なし)
WebServer (記載なし)
Copyright © 2013 Power Future Co., Ltd.